Job Responsibilities

  • Accreditation
    • Plan and prepare annual Program Evaluation and Clinical Competency Committees meetings.
    • Submit required reports to GME and ACGME by deadlines.
    • Review and update program information for web ads.
    • Document and submit program changes requiring GMEC approval.
  • Recruitment
    • Coordinate recruitment activities.
    • Prepare and distribute information to interested applicants.
    • Arrange interview logistics and distribute interview packets.
    • Organize materials and meetings for ranking and matching residents.
    • Update NRMP match information and enter rank lists.
  • Onboarding
    • Communicate with incoming residents on important dates and events.
    • Oversee activities for incoming residents, including licensing, certifications, and workspace arrangement.
    • Organize the “in program” schedule and welcome events.
  • Schedules/Rotations
    • Create and obtain approval for annual and clinic rotation schedules.
    • Develop rotation schedules that meet curriculum requirements.
  • Evaluations
    • Manage active evaluations for compliance and accuracy.
    • Coordinate evaluation review and delivery processes.
    • Prepare and distribute aggregate faculty evaluations.
  • Conferences
    • Assist with daily conference administration and logistics.
    • Support weekly Grand Rounds administration.
  • Compliance/Testing
    • Ensure accurate leave times are recorded in MedHub and Workday.
    • Support the preparation and administering of In Training exams and Board Prep exams.
    • Handle correspondence from agencies requesting verification of residency.
  • Reports and Presentations
    • Work with Chair, program director, and other residency coordinators to prepare reports and complete surveys.
    • Aid in the preparation of documents for RRC.
  • Graduating/Alumni
    • Plan graduation activities with program director.
    • Coordinate logistics of events with the planning team.
    • Ensure graduating trainees complete transition items.
    • Complete documents for former residents.
    • Submit forms for certificates, verifications, and answer surveys/questionnaires.
    • Engage alumni in program events and information.
  • Other Duties
    • Manage faculty information and data.
    • Manage website and social media updates.
    • Plan and manage program events (resident social events, welcome events, research, and speaker events).
    • Plan GME and Coordinator Council Training events and meetings.
    • Complete visiting trainee requests and documentation.

Qualifications

  • Four (4) years of relevant work experience.
  • Five (5) years’ experience in an academic setting preferred.
  • Knowledge of medical terminology and residency programs.
  • Experience in ERAS, ACGME, MedHub, C-TAGME, Workday, and Qgenda.
  • Communication, computer, interpersonal, organization, multi-tasking, time management, attention to detail skills.
